Here you will find a list of scales and measures that could be useful in measuring outcomes in recovery community centers (RCCs) and studies on RCCs. We included several of these scales in our nationwide survey of RCC directors. This paper summarizes their thoughts on these measures.
In the list below, we grouped scales into conceptual groups. For each scale, you can open a PDF containing the following information:
Name of scale
Citation(s) for scale
Verbatim items on the scale, as presented to study participants
Scoring instructions, as used by the research team
